Unexplained Mysteries of World War II

Short description

The annals of World War II are mined with captivating cases of strange coincidences, ominous premonitions, and baffling mysteries. William Breuer's painstaking research has yielded over 100 fascinating historical accounts, including: Who really was behind the mysterious fire that destroyed the famed ocean liner Normandie?; Was the ominous "Deadly Double" ad in The New Yorker a coded leak announcing the upcoming bombing of Pearl Harbor?; and What saved the Duke of Windsor from Hitler's grasp, and the Allies from a crippling strategic setback?
